Composition:
ACARBOSE-50MG
Uses:
Treatment of Type 2 diabetes mellitus
Medicinal Benefits:
REBOSE 50MG TABLET is an anti-diabetic drug used to treat type 2 diabetes, especially in patients whose blood sugar levels are not controlled by diet and exercise alone. REBOSE 50MG TABLET may be used alone or in combination with other medicines. REBOSE 50MG TABLET inhibits the action of intestinal enzymes that break down complex sugars and starches into simple sugars. Thereby delaying the absorption of sugar into the blood and reducing the abnormal rise in blood sugar levels after meals. It is essential to control blood sugar levels to avoid any further complications of diabetes, such as eye problems, kidney damage, eye damage and loss of limbs.

No, you are not recommended to take REBOSE 50MG TABLET with digoxin (used to treat heart problems) as co-administration of these two medicines may decrease the effectiveness of digoxin by reducing its amount in the blood. If you are supposed to use these medicines together, you are advised to contact your doctor so that the dose may be adjusted appropriately and used safely.
Yes, REBOSE 50MG TABLET may cause diarrhoea as a common side effect. Intake of household sugar (cane sugar) or foods containing it can also lead to diarrhoea or severe discomfort in the stomach. However, if the condition worsens or persist for more than 2 or 3 days, please consult your doctor.
No, REBOSE 50MG TABLET alone does not cause low blood sugar. However, low blood sugar may occur if REBOSE 50MG TABLET is taken along with other antidiabetic medicines, alcohol intake, exercise more than usual, delay or miss snacks or meal. However, if you experience any signs of low blood pressure such as dizziness, nausea, light-headedness, dehydration or fainting, please consult a doctor.
You are not advised to take more than the recommended dose of REBOSE 50MG TABLET as it may cause REBOSE 50MG TABLET overdose resulting in increased flatulence (gas), stomach discomfort, diarrhoea. In case of overdose, avoid intake of drinks and foods containing carbohydrates for the next 4 to 6 hours. However, if the symptoms persist or worsen, please consult a doctor.
No, you are not recommended to stop taking REBOSE 50MG TABLET on your own as discontinuing REBOSE 50MG TABLET suddenly may cause recurring symptoms or worsen the condition. However, if you experience any difficulty while taking REBOSE 50MG TABLET, please consult your doctor so that an alternate medicine may be prescribed.
The side effects of REBOSE 50MG TABLET include stomach pain, diarrhoea and flatulence (gas). If these side effects persist or worsen, please consult your doctor.
No, REBOSE 50MG TABLET does not help in weight loss, and it should only be used to manage diabetes.
If you experience low blood sugar while taking REBOSE 50MG TABLET, you should take glucose. Avoid complex carbohydrates and sucrose as acarbose can delay the absorption of complex sugars.
REBOSE 50MG TABLET prevents the digestion of carbohydrates which causes the build-up of undigested carbohydrates in the colon (large intestine). Bacterial fermentation of the stored carbohydrates causes intestinal gas, leading to flatulence and stomach pain.
REBOSE 50MG TABLET should be taken with meals either chewed with the first bite of food or swallowed whole with water. Use as advised by the doctor.
If you forget to take a dose of REBOSE 50MG TABLET, take it as soon as you remember. But, if it is time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and take your regular dose. Do not take a double dose to make up for a forgotten dose.
Patients who are allergic to REBOSE 50MG TABLET, have inflammation or ulceration of intestine (eg Crohn’s disease), severe liver disease, or intestinal obstruction (cramping pain, vomiting, severe constipation, and lack of flatus), large hernia or an intestinal disease where food is not digested or absorbed properly should avoid taking REBOSE 50MG TABLET. Also, pregnant or breastfeeding women should avoid taking REBOSE 50MG TABLET.
